QUARTET
\kwɔːtˈɛt], \kwɔːtˈɛt], \k_w_ɔː_t_ˈɛ_t]\
Sort: Oldest first
-
four people considered as a unit; "he joined a barbershop quartet"; "the foursome teed off before 9 a.m."
-
a set of four similar things considered as a unit

A musical composition in four parts for four voices or instruments; the four performers of such a composition; anything made up of four. Also, quartette.
